Just to add a bit of information. How about starting your evening at a rooftop bar. There must be about a 100 in Bangkok, and about 20 really good ones. You guys should try Above Eleven at Sukhumvit Soi 11, at the top of Fraser Suites. I like it because of the Peruvian drinks they have. You can then go directly downstairs to Levels which is in the same street.

My personal favourite is Octave bar at the Marriot hotel. Not to be mistaken with the JW Marriot hotel.

Was there a few weeks ago and they still have daily happy hours from 5-7 (since at least 2 years), every day, 7 days a week. (They offer about 10 cocktails with happy hour deals) Not a bad deal to start there, have a few cocktails while watching the sunset. It's at the 49nd floor so that's not bad either. Also close to Thonglor BTS station. It does not get real crowded either, there is always place to sit, even on friday around 6 pm.

Typical nice evening in Bangkok for me would be Octave, hop on over to Sukhumvit Soi 11 to listen to some live music at Apoteka and then head on over to Levels (though a lot of freelancers) or RCA. I usually stay at the president palace in Soi 11, right across from Levels.

Just thought I would share some info that I've heard bits and pieces of the last couple of days.

Clubs have been shutting at 1am these past couple of days and it looks like there is a struggle in the Thonglor Police Command.

If that is the case, and a Pro-Junta commander is incoming there might be a lot of pressure coming under nightlife venues going forward as the 'official closing time' is actually 2am.

I am highly doubtful it would be sustained but it did happen this time last year as well and it really changed the dynamics of Bangkok's nightlife. It usually means people either

A) Go out earlier - like 8 instead of 11 or
B) Don't go out at all

So keep an eye on that and I will come back with more info as it becomes relevant.
